What is mobile motorcycle valeting?

Mobile motorcycle valeting is a service where a professional comes to your location to wash and clean your motorbike. It’s a safe, convenient, and hassle-free way to keep your motorcycle looking its best, without having to lift a finger.

Mobile motorcycle valeting costs

A mobile motorcycle valet can cost anywhere from £25 for a basic wash to over £200 for a full detail with extras like clay bar treatment, polishing, and ceramic coating. The cost varies based on your location, as well as the size, type, and condition of your bike.

Here’s a quick overview of common motorbike valeting packages to give you a better idea of what to expect.

Standard Valet (£25-£50)

A standard motorcycle valet usually includes washing the bike, cleaning the chain, and hand drying and wiping surfaces. It may also include polishing metals and plastics, cleaning mirrors, lights and tyres.

Premium Valet (£80-£100+)

A premium motorcycle valet goes further than a standard valet, typically including a deep clean, detailing small parts and crevices, treating plastics, rubber, and leather, as well as waxing and polishing. Depending on the package, a premium valet may also include advanced services like clay bar treatment, ceramic coating, and paint correction.

How long does a mobile motorcycle valet take?

The time required to complete a mobile motorcycle valet depends on several factors, including the size of the bike, the level of dirt, and the chosen package.

For example, a standard valet typically takes around 15-30 minutes, while a full valet with premium features such as waxing and paint correction can take one to two hours or more. It’s best to check with the valeter before booking to confirm the exact duration of the service.

Can any type of motorcycle get a mobile valet?

Yes, mobile valeting is available for all types of motorcycles. However, if you own an older or classic bike with delicate or fragile parts, it’s a good idea to let the valeter know when booking. This ensures they can take extra care and use the proper precautions to avoid any potential damage.

Is mobile motorcycle valeting safe?

Yes, mobile motorcycle valeting is a safe and efficient way to get your motorbike cleaned. Most professional valeters are experts in cleaning all types of vehicles using safe products and techniques, such as the two-bucket method and hand washing. These methods help prevent scratches and swirl marks, keeping your motorbike’s paintwork in top condition.

How often should I get a motorcycle valet?

How often you should get a motorcycle valet depends on how often you ride and what you use your bike for. If you ride only occasionally, a valet every 3-6 months is usually enough. However, if you use your bike regularly, such as every week or daily, you’ll need more frequent valets, typically every 4-6 weeks.

The good news is that many mobile motorcycle valeters offer top-up maintenance packages. These allow you to schedule regular basic valets at a discounted price, often after a full or deep clean.
